A Transformative Journey Concludes: Coach Reno's Departure from Yale
Coach Tony Reno's 14-year chapter with the Yale Bulldogs has officially closed, with the esteemed head coach stepping down from his position. His decision, announced on Tuesday, is rooted in personal health matters, concluding a period of significant growth and achievement for the football program under his guidance. Reno's leadership saw the Bulldogs secure five Ivy League championships and achieve their inaugural FCS playoff berth in 2025, a testament to his dedication and strategic vision.
Celebrating a Remarkable Career: Highlights of Coach Reno's Tenure
Tony Reno, at 52 years old, assumed the head coaching role for the Bulldogs in January 2012. Under his stewardship, the team reached new heights, including their first-ever FCS playoff appearance in 2025. A notable moment from that season was an extraordinary comeback victory against Youngstown State, where Yale overcame a 28-point deficit to win 43-42 in the first round, before eventually falling to the national champions, Montana State. His impressive 83-49 record places him second only to the legendary Carm Cozza in Yale's football history.

An Athletic Director's Tribute: Vicky Chun on Reno's Enduring Legacy
Vicky Chun, Yale's athletic director, lauded Coach Reno's leadership as truly "transformational." She underscored that his influence extended far beyond mere wins and championships, deeply inspiring countless individuals within the athletic department and the broader university community. Chun highlighted Reno's integrity, humility, and unwavering commitment to excellence, noting his deep care for his players' holistic development – both on the field and in their personal lives. His profound dedication to Yale and its student-athletes will, she asserted, establish a lasting legacy for generations to come.
The Future Beckons: Yale Initiates Search for New Head Coach
Following Coach Reno's departure, Yale University has promptly commenced a nationwide search to identify the next head coach for its football program. The university aims to find a leader who can build upon the strong foundation Reno established and continue to uphold the tradition of excellence in Yale Football.
